Output 5376858f124ac75e084561e3936060b9e305e89edb384d07d1f46b0d8356b41a:1

value
25790774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e69f2cafe445ba785745ccfa433cce31a0e954d3 OP_EQUAL
address
3NiS2JkyFmqvHt4KPn2GCSSP2WHEMuMmv7
transaction
5376858f124ac75e084561e3936060b9e305e89edb384d07d1f46b0d8356b41a
confirmations
271110
spent
true